Recommended update for dracut

This update for dracut provides the following fixes:

- Ensure dracut.sh responds properly to hostonly_cmdline option. (bsc#1048748)
- Switch FIPS checking to use the libkcapi based fipscheck toolset. (bsc#1048565)
- Fix some ISCSI boot failures due to handle_firmware timing out. (bsc#1032284)
- Fix system shutdown when in initrd rescue mode. (bsc#1048698)
- Make sure dracut looks for modules.builtin in the correct path when used with the --kmoddir
option. (bsc#1048606)
- Ensure the ssh-client is usable by including the NSS plugin libraries configured in
nsswitch.conf. (bsc#1021846)
- Sync initramfs after creation to ensure it is properly written to disk when using fadump
and invoking crash right after service start. (bsc#1049113)
- Don't detect crc32.ko as built-in, as in some kernel configurations it may also appear as
a module. (bsc#1054538)
- Enable systemd-based core dumps for initrd. (bsc#1054809)
- Add missing coreutils dependency for initrd macros. (bsc#1055492)

This update was imported from the SUSE:SLE-12-SP2:Update update project.
